# arXiv study: semantic metadata still lifts FAIR precision for agentic data retrieval

An arXiv preprint in information retrieval asks whether large language model agents still need semantic metadata such as schema.org when retrieving machine-actionable datasets, or can navigate the open web alone.

The authors compare a Baseline Agent searching billions of open-web documents with a Semantic Agent using a corpus of 90 million datasets annotated with schema.org. An LLM-as-a-judge pipeline mapped to FAIR principles scores semantic relevance, accessibility, and computational utility of retrieved results.

The Semantic Agent achieved 44.9% higher precision for metadata-rich registries and 46.6% higher precision for pages with machine-readable downloads among its returned results. The Baseline Agent more often hit last-mile utility failures, including prose-heavy pages (20.1% of results) and portal landing pages (8.5%) rather than actual data pages.

The Baseline Agent answered 40% more questions and thus covered more queries, but the Semantic Agent delivered 65.7% higher overall precision on FAIR-compliant datasets. The authors conclude that unstructured retrieval supports broad exploratory tasks while structured metadata ecosystems remain foundational for reliable, execution-oriented autonomous workflows.
